Understanding AWS Database Migration Service
In todayβs fast-evolving digital landscape, businesses are under constant pressure to modernize their infrastructure while ensuring uninterrupted operations. Database migration, however, often introduces challenges such as downtime, data inconsistency, and operational risks.
AWS Database Migration Service (AWS DMS) is designed to address these challenges by enabling organizations to migrate databases securely and efficiently with minimal disruption. It supports migrations between on-premises systems, cloud environments, and even between different database engines, making it a flexible solution for modern businesses.
Organizations adopting AWS DMS can continue running their applications during migration, ensuring business continuity while transitioning to a more scalable and cost-efficient cloud environment.
Key Benefits of AWS DMS
Minimal Downtime
AWS DMS enables near-zero downtime migrations, ensuring that business operations remain unaffected during the transition process.
Continuous Data Replication
With Change Data Capture (CDC), AWS DMS continuously replicates changes from the source to the target database, ensuring real-time synchronization and data integrity.
Support for Heterogeneous Migrations
Businesses can migrate between different database engines, enabling modernization from legacy systems to open-source or cloud-native databases.
Fully Managed Service
As a managed AWS service, DMS eliminates the need for manual infrastructure setup, handling scaling, monitoring, and maintenance automatically.
Cost Optimization
With a pay-as-you-go pricing model, organizations can significantly reduce upfront costs associated with traditional migration approaches.
How AWS DMS Works
Source and Target Configuration
Define the source database and the destination environment on AWS.
Schema Conversion
Use AWS Schema Conversion Tool (SCT) to convert database structures where required.
Replication Instance Setup
Deploy a managed replication instance to handle data transfer.
Migration Execution
Perform full data load and enable continuous replication for ongoing changes.
Business Use Cases
- Migrating on-premises databases to AWS cloud
- Modernizing legacy database systems
- Enabling real-time data replication for analytics
- Setting up disaster recovery and backup solutions
Use Case: Zero-Downtime Migration for E-commerce Platform
Challenges Faced
- Limited scalability of on-premises database
- Downtime risks during migration
- Increasing maintenance and infrastructure costs
- Need for real-time data availability for analytics
Solution Implemented
Operisoft leveraged AWS DMS along with AWS Schema Conversion Tool (SCT) to migrate the clientβs database from an on-premises MySQL system to Amazon Aurora.
Results Achieved
- Zero downtime migration during business hours
- 40% improvement in database performance
- Reduced infrastructure costs by 30%
- Enabled real-time analytics with continuously synced data
Business Impact
The client was able to handle peak traffic efficiently, improve customer experience, and scale seamlessly without worrying about infrastructure limitations.
Business Outcomes
Organizations leveraging AWS DMS for database migration can achieve measurable business impact, including:
β’ Reduce migration downtime by up to 80%
β’ Lower infrastructure and operational costs
β’ Improve data availability for analytics in near real-time
β’ Enable faster cloud adoption and modernization
How Operisoft Simplifies Database Migration
- Assessment and Strategy
- Seamless Migration Execution
- Modernization and Optimization
- Ongoing Support and Management
Conclusion
Database migration is often perceived as complex and risky, but with the right tools and expertise, it can become a catalyst for innovation and growth.
